E124: Why Government Rules Make Homes Unaffordable - w/ Bryan Caplan

Economist Bryan Caplan joins the show to discuss his new graphic novel Build Baby Build: The Science and Ethics of Housing Regulation. We unpack how housing prices have skyrocketed due to artificial scarcity created by zoning laws, minimum lot sizes, height restrictions, parking mandates, and outdated local codes.

Caplan argues that cutting these burdensome rules could massively increase supply, slash housing costs, reduce inequality, and improve economic mobility—all without sacrificing safety or quality of life. Along the way, we discuss the Empire State Building, million-dollar trailer parks, licensing bottlenecks in the trades, and why even small towns have become "Ponzi schemes of sprawl."

Topics Covered:

  • Why housing is so expensive—and who’s to blame
  • The 1926 Village of Euclid case and the birth of zoning
  • How regulation strangles supply and drives up prices
  • YIMBYism vs. NIMBYism
  • Texas vs. California housing policy
  • Infrastructure and the cost of sprawl
  • Licensing and labor bottlenecks in construction
  • How deregulation could boost GDP, mobility, and fertility
  • The politics of fear and the myth of “smart growth”
